Home
last modified time | relevance | path

Searched refs:timer (Results 151 – 175 of 2757) sorted by relevance

12345678910>>...111

/openbmc/qemu/hw/m68k/
H A Dmcf5208.c46 ptimer_state *timer; member
80 ptimer_transaction_begin(s->timer); in m5208_timer_write()
82 ptimer_stop(s->timer); in m5208_timer_write()
87 ptimer_set_freq(s->timer, (SYS_FREQ / 2) / prescale); in m5208_timer_write()
92 ptimer_set_limit(s->timer, limit, 0); in m5208_timer_write()
95 ptimer_run(s->timer, 0); in m5208_timer_write()
96 ptimer_transaction_commit(s->timer); in m5208_timer_write()
99 ptimer_transaction_begin(s->timer); in m5208_timer_write()
104 ptimer_set_count(s->timer, value); in m5208_timer_write()
108 ptimer_transaction_commit(s->timer); in m5208_timer_write()
[all …]
H A Dmcf5206.c28 ptimer_state *timer; member
62 ptimer_transaction_begin(s->timer); in m5206_timer_recalibrate()
63 ptimer_stop(s->timer); in m5206_timer_recalibrate()
88 ptimer_set_limit(s->timer, s->trr, 0); in m5206_timer_recalibrate()
90 ptimer_run(s->timer, 0); in m5206_timer_recalibrate()
92 ptimer_transaction_commit(s->timer); in m5206_timer_recalibrate()
138 ptimer_transaction_begin(s->timer); in m5206_timer_write()
139 ptimer_set_count(s->timer, val); in m5206_timer_write()
140 ptimer_transaction_commit(s->timer); in m5206_timer_write()
170 m5206_timer_state *timer[2]; member
[all …]
/openbmc/linux/arch/arm64/boot/dts/ti/
H A Dk3-am62-mcu.dtsi28 mcu_timer0: timer@4800000 {
29 compatible = "ti,am654-timer";
34 ti,timer-pwm;
38 mcu_timer1: timer@4810000 {
39 compatible = "ti,am654-timer";
44 ti,timer-pwm;
48 mcu_timer2: timer@4820000 {
49 compatible = "ti,am654-timer";
54 ti,timer-pwm;
58 mcu_timer3: timer@4830000 {
[all …]
H A Dk3-am62a-mcu.dtsi23 mcu_timer0: timer@4800000 {
24 compatible = "ti,am654-timer";
29 ti,timer-pwm;
33 mcu_timer1: timer@4810000 {
34 compatible = "ti,am654-timer";
39 ti,timer-pwm;
43 mcu_timer2: timer@4820000 {
44 compatible = "ti,am654-timer";
49 ti,timer-pwm;
53 mcu_timer3: timer@4830000 {
[all …]
/openbmc/qemu/hw/watchdog/
H A Dwdt_ib700.c47 QEMUTimer *timer; member
70 timer_mod(s->timer, qemu_clock_get_ns(QEMU_CLOCK_VIRTUAL) + timeout); in ib700_write_enable_reg()
80 timer_del(s->timer); in ib700_write_disable_reg()
91 timer_del(s->timer); in ib700_timer_expired()
99 VMSTATE_TIMER_PTR(timer, IB700State),
116 s->timer = timer_new_ns(QEMU_CLOCK_VIRTUAL, ib700_timer_expired, s); in wdt_ib700_realize()
128 timer_del(s->timer); in wdt_ib700_reset()
/openbmc/linux/drivers/net/ethernet/dec/tulip/
H A Dpnic2.c81 struct tulip_private *tp = from_timer(tp, t, timer); in pnic2_timer()
91 mod_timer(&tp->timer, RUN_AT(next_tick)); in pnic2_timer()
326 del_timer_sync(&tp->timer); in pnic2_lnk_change()
328 tp->timer.expires = RUN_AT(3*HZ); in pnic2_lnk_change()
329 add_timer(&tp->timer); in pnic2_lnk_change()
351 del_timer_sync(&tp->timer); in pnic2_lnk_change()
353 tp->timer.expires = RUN_AT(3*HZ); in pnic2_lnk_change()
354 add_timer(&tp->timer); in pnic2_lnk_change()
375 del_timer_sync(&tp->timer); in pnic2_lnk_change()
377 tp->timer.expires = RUN_AT(3*HZ); in pnic2_lnk_change()
[all …]
/openbmc/qemu/hw/gpio/
H A Dgpio_key.c40 QEMUTimer *timer; member
49 VMSTATE_TIMER_PTR(timer, GPIOKEYState),
58 timer_del(s->timer); in gpio_key_reset()
66 timer_del(s->timer); in gpio_key_timer_expired()
74 timer_mod(s->timer, in gpio_key_set_irq()
85 s->timer = timer_new_ms(QEMU_CLOCK_VIRTUAL, gpio_key_timer_expired, s); in gpio_key_realize()
/openbmc/linux/Documentation/devicetree/bindings/timer/
H A Damlogic,meson6-timer.yaml4 $id: http://devicetree.org/schemas/timer/amlogic,meson6-timer.yaml#
15 const: amlogic,meson6-timer
22 description: per-timer event interrupts
45 timer@c1109940 {
46 compatible = "amlogic,meson6-timer";
H A Dactions,owl-timer.txt4 - compatible : "actions,s500-timer" for S500
5 "actions,s700-timer" for S700
6 "actions,s900-timer" for S900
15 timer@b0168000 {
16 compatible = "actions,s500-timer";
H A Dralink,rt2880-timer.yaml4 $id: http://devicetree.org/schemas/timer/ralink,rt2880-timer.yaml#
14 const: ralink,rt2880-timer
35 timer@100 {
36 compatible = "ralink,rt2880-timer";
H A Darm,sp804.yaml4 $id: http://devicetree.org/schemas/timer/arm,sp804.yaml#
16 independently for each timer.
18 There is a viriant of Arm SP804: Hisilicon 64-bit SP804 timer. Some Hisilicon
42 If two interrupts are listed, those are the interrupts for timer
44 either a combined interrupt or the sole interrupt of one timer, as
55 Clocks driving the dual timer hardware. This list should
61 - description: clock for timer 1
62 - description: clock for timer 2
75 controller, this property specifies which timer is connected to this
91 timer0: timer@fc800000 {
H A Dspreadtrum,sprd-timer.txt9 - compatible: should be "sprd,sc9860-timer" for SC9860 platform.
10 - reg: The register address of the timer device.
11 - interrupts: Should contain the interrupt for the timer device.
15 timer@40050000 {
16 compatible = "sprd,sc9860-timer";
/openbmc/linux/Documentation/devicetree/bindings/watchdog/
H A Dnuvoton,npcm-wdt.txt3 Nuvoton NPCM timer module provides five 24-bit timer counters, and a watchdog.
12 - interrupts : Contain the timer interrupt with flags for
16 - clocks : phandle of timer reference clock.
18 timer (usually 25000000).
25 timer@f000801c {
H A Dmarvell,cn10624-wdt.yaml47 marvell,wdt-timer-index:
52 An SoC have many timers (up to 64), firmware can reserve one or more timer
53 for some other use case and configures one of the global timer as watchdog
54 timer. Firmware will update this field with the timer number configured
55 as watchdog timer.
79 marvell,wdt-timer-index = <63>;
/openbmc/linux/arch/arm/boot/dts/ti/omap/
H A Domap3-beagle-ab4.dts25 timer@0 {
26 /delete-property/ti,timer-alwon;
30 /* Preferred always-on timer for clocksource */
34 timer@0 {
39 /* Preferred timer for clockevent */
43 timer@0 {
/openbmc/openbmc-tools/dbus_sensor_tester/
H A Dmain.cpp19 void on_loop(boost::asio::steady_timer *timer, in on_loop() argument
52 timer->expires_from_now(std::chrono::seconds(update_interval_seconds)); in on_loop()
53 timer->async_wait(std::bind_front(on_loop, timer)); in on_loop()
98 boost::asio::steady_timer timer(io); in main() local
99 timer.expires_from_now(std::chrono::seconds(update_interval_seconds)); in main()
100 timer.async_wait(std::bind_front(on_loop, &timer)); in main()
/openbmc/dbus-sensors/src/
H A DThresholds.hpp76 for (TimerPair& timer : timers) in hasActiveTimer()
78 if (timer.first.used) in hasActiveTimer()
80 if ((timer.first.level == threshold.level) && in hasActiveTimer()
81 (timer.first.direction == threshold.direction) && in hasActiveTimer()
82 (timer.first.assert == assert)) in hasActiveTimer()
94 for (TimerPair& timer : timers) in stopTimer()
96 timerUsed = timer.first; in stopTimer()
103 timer.second.cancel(); in stopTimer()
/openbmc/linux/drivers/usb/phy/
H A Dphy-fsl-usb.c365 timer = a_wait_vrise_tmr; in fsl_otg_get_timer()
368 timer = a_wait_vrise_tmr; in fsl_otg_get_timer()
371 timer = a_wait_vrise_tmr; in fsl_otg_get_timer()
386 timer = NULL; in fsl_otg_get_timer()
389 return timer; in fsl_otg_get_timer()
404 timer->count = timer->expires; in fsl_otg_add_timer()
407 timer->count = timer->expires; in fsl_otg_add_timer()
416 if (!timer) in fsl_otg_fsm_add_timer()
429 if (tmp_timer == timer) in fsl_otg_del_timer()
430 list_del(&timer->list); in fsl_otg_del_timer()
[all …]
H A Dphy-fsl-usb.h346 struct fsl_otg_timer *timer; in otg_timer_initializer() local
348 timer = kmalloc(sizeof(struct fsl_otg_timer), GFP_KERNEL); in otg_timer_initializer()
349 if (!timer) in otg_timer_initializer()
351 timer->function = function; in otg_timer_initializer()
352 timer->expires = expires; in otg_timer_initializer()
353 timer->data = data; in otg_timer_initializer()
354 return timer; in otg_timer_initializer()
376 void fsl_otg_add_timer(struct otg_fsm *fsm, void *timer);
377 void fsl_otg_del_timer(struct otg_fsm *fsm, void *timer);
/openbmc/linux/tools/testing/selftests/bpf/progs/
H A Dasync_stack_depth.c8 struct bpf_timer timer; member
19 static int timer_cb(void *map, int *key, struct bpf_timer *timer) in timer_cb() argument
26 static int bad_timer_cb(void *map, int *key, struct bpf_timer *timer) in bad_timer_cb() argument
44 return bpf_timer_set_callback(&elem->timer, timer_cb) + buf[0]; in pseudo_call_check()
58 return bpf_timer_set_callback(&elem->timer, bad_timer_cb) + buf[0]; in async_call_root_check()
/openbmc/linux/arch/arm/boot/dts/st/
H A Dstm32mp131.dtsi93 timer {
133 timer@1 {
169 timer@2 {
203 timer@3 {
239 timer@4 {
264 timer@5 {
284 timer@6 {
319 timer {
1136 timer {
1165 timer {
[all …]
/openbmc/u-boot/arch/arm/dts/
H A Dstm32f429.dtsi77 timer2: timer@40000000 {
99 timer@1 {
128 timer@2 {
157 timer@3 {
185 timer@4 {
209 timer@5 {
233 timer@6 {
254 timer@11 {
412 timer@0 {
433 timer@7 {
[all …]
/openbmc/linux/drivers/auxdisplay/
H A Dline-display.c33 struct linedisp *linedisp = from_timer(linedisp, t, timer); in linedisp_scroll()
56 mod_timer(&linedisp->timer, jiffies + linedisp->scroll_rate); in linedisp_scroll()
77 del_timer_sync(&linedisp->timer); in linedisp_display()
107 linedisp_scroll(&linedisp->timer); in linedisp_display()
174 del_timer_sync(&linedisp->timer); in scroll_step_ms_store()
176 linedisp_scroll(&linedisp->timer); in scroll_step_ms_store()
225 timer_setup(&linedisp->timer, linedisp_scroll, 0); in linedisp_register()
241 del_timer_sync(&linedisp->timer); in linedisp_register()
255 del_timer_sync(&linedisp->timer); in linedisp_unregister()
/openbmc/u-boot/drivers/timer/
H A Dmpc83xx_timer.c95 struct udevice *timer; in interrupt_init() local
100 ret = uclass_first_device_err(UCLASS_TIMER, &timer); in interrupt_init()
107 timer_priv = dev_get_priv(timer); in interrupt_init()
148 struct udevice *timer = gd->timer; in timer_interrupt() local
156 if (!timer) in timer_interrupt()
159 priv = dev_get_priv(timer); in timer_interrupt()
/openbmc/linux/sound/core/seq/
H A Dseq_queue.c112 q->timer = snd_seq_timer_new(); in queue_new()
116 snd_seq_timer_delete(&q->timer); in queue_new()
133 snd_seq_timer_stop(q->timer); in queue_delete()
141 snd_seq_timer_delete(&q->timer); in queue_delete()
320 &q->timer->cur_time); in snd_seq_enqueue_event()
445 tmr = queue->timer; in snd_seq_queue_timer_open()
506 snd_seq_timer_defaults(queue->timer); in queue_use()
660 if (! snd_seq_timer_start(q->timer)) in snd_seq_queue_process_event()
670 snd_seq_timer_stop(q->timer); in snd_seq_queue_process_event()
691 if (snd_seq_timer_set_skew(q->timer, in snd_seq_queue_process_event()
[all …]

12345678910>>...111